Front Cover published in Macromolecules 2020, 53 (17)

A front cover was published in the current issue of Macromolecules (volume 53, issue 17) featuring the article "End-Adsorbing Chains in Polymer Brushes: Pathway to Highly Metastable Switchable Surfaces" by Markus Koch, Dirk Romeis, and Jens-Uwe Sommer.

The cover illustrates the surface properties, which can be modified in a switchable manner by polymer brushes (blue) containing a minority fraction of longer chains (red) with adsorption-active end groups. External stimuli can induce a transition between the exposed state and the hidden adsorbed state, which are separated by a large free-energy barrier.
